//! Lazy value initialization.


use crate::std::fmt;

use super::internal::{Inner, Visitor};
use super::{Error, ValueBag};

impl<'v> ValueBag<'v> {
    /// Get a value from a fillable slot.

    pub fn from_fill<T>(value: &'v T) -> Self
    where
        T: Fill,
    {
        ValueBag {
            inner: Inner::Fill { value },
        }
    }
}

/// A type that requires extra work to convert into a [`ValueBag`](struct.ValueBag.html).

///

/// This trait is an advanced initialization API.

/// It's intended for erased values coming from other logging frameworks that may need

/// to perform extra work to determine the concrete type to use.

pub trait Fill {
    /// Fill a value.

    fn fill(&self, slot: &mut Slot) -> Result<(), Error>;
}

impl<'a, T> Fill for &'a T
where
    T: Fill + ?Sized,
{
    fn fill(&self, slot: &mut Slot) -> Result<(), Error> {
        (**self).fill(slot)
    }
}

/// A value slot to fill using the [`Fill`](trait.Fill.html) trait.

pub struct Slot<'s, 'f> {
    filled: bool,
    visitor: &'s mut dyn Visitor<'f>,
}

impl<'s, 'f> fmt::Debug for Slot<'s, 'f> {
    f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
        f.debug_struct("Slot").finish()
    }
}

impl<'s, 'f> Slot<'s, 'f> {
    pub(super) fn new(visitor: &'s mut dyn Visitor<'f>) -> Self {
        Slot {
            visitor,
            filled: false,
        }
    }

    pub(super) fn fill<F>(&mut self, f: F) -> Result<(), Error>
    where
        F: FnOnce(&mut dyn Visitor<'f>) -> Result<(), Error>,
    {
        assert!(!self.filled, "the slot has already been filled");
        self.filled = true;

        f(self.visitor)
    }

    /// Fill the slot with a value.

    ///

    /// The given value doesn't need to satisfy any particular lifetime constraints.

    ///

    /// # Panics

    ///

    /// Calling more than a single `fill` method on this slot will panic.

    pub fn fill_any<T>(&mut self, value: T) -> Result<(), Error>
    where
        T: Into<ValueBag<'f>>,
    {
        self.fill(|visitor| value.into().inner.visit(visitor))
    }
}
